VisioCablePro - CRP Core Removal Punch
- Preparation of cable samples for further processing
- Applicable for cable types with solid core cross-sections
- E.g. Sample preparation for cutting with ORC family

- Measuring device to detect the twist/lay/pitch length of sheathed cables
- Measurements according to the standards LV212 und LV122
- The twist length of the sample is measured without removing the sheath → this ensures a precise measurement
- Traditional methods manipulate the sample (cable stripping or unwinding of conductors) → a precise measurement is not possible anymore
- Via a PC connection, the measuring results can directly be exported
- Fully automatic: By clicking one button, the measuring sensor automatically moves along the sample

VisioCablePro
VisioCablePro® is a brand of iiM GmbH - by Exaktera.
VisioCablePro® - Cable measurement engineering has especially been developed to carry out geometrical measurements, which specifically fulfill cable producers requirements to measure the geometrical features of insulating skins and cable sheaths.
